Nexus Launches Major Upgrade Dubbed Tritium


“Nexus releases Tritium, a revolutionary register-based contract engine, that processes 2k to 25k contracts per second. Tritium is designed to be scalable, decentralized, and user friendly with an innovative decentralized login system for DApp developers to build with. This eliminates the requirement of users to store private keys.” - more information here.

NEXUS NEWS
With the release of the Tritium upgrade, the Software Stack will contain an API that gives direct access to features such as Contracts, Tokens, Assets, and Decentralized Exchange. Developers have the option to use the API for new or existing web applications, or to build custom modules that embed directly into the Nexus Wallet.

Check Nexus API Here : https://nexusearth.com/api-interface

Modules can be built using other available APIs, such as those for trading dashboards or alternative cryptocurrency wallets.
